Common skin concerns we see in Pompano Beach
Sun damage, clogged pores, and sensitivity from waxing come up a lot here. Living near the beach means more UV exposure and humidity. That mix can mean more pigmentation, more sweat-related breakouts, and more irritation after hair removal. I help clients with hyperpigmentation from old sunspots, recurring ingrowns after waxing, and the breakouts that show up when humidity spikes. We also talk about realistic timelines. Fading a sunspot takes time. Preventing ingrowns takes habit. You’ll get a plan that accounts for your lifestyle, outdoor time, and how soon you want to see results.

Skincare routines that work in humidity and sun
Florida humidity changes everything. Lightweight gels and water-based serums often beat heavy creams for daytime. Ingredients like niacinamide, azelaic acid, and hyaluronic acid are great for balancing oil and calming inflammation. And yes, sunscreen is non-negotiable. Use a broad spectrum SPF 30 or higher every morning. For active sunspots, we layer sun protection with targeted creams at night. Nighttime is when repair happens, so that’s when retinoids and brightening acids do their work. I’ll tailor timing so you get results without irritation. It’s not complicated. It’s consistent.
Waxing and vajacials: education and aftercare
Waxing and vajacials are intimate services that need respect and education. I walk clients through prep, what to avoid before an appointment, and how to care for skin after. That includes avoiding heavy workouts for 24 hours, skipping hot tubs, and using gentle, fragrance-free care while the area calms down. For vajacials we may include light extraction, soothing masks, and ingrown prevention. The goal is healthy skin in intimate areas. That means fewer bumps, less pigmentation, and longer-lasting smoothness. Follow the plan, and you’ll see a difference.
Body sculpting basics and how skin health ties in
Body sculpting isn’t just about shape, it’s about how skin adapts afterward. Treatments like cavitation, radiofrequency, and EMS can change contour and skin tightness. When we combine these with good skincare, hydration, and realistic expectations, results stick longer. I explain how treatments work, what to expect during sessions, and how to care for skin in the treated area. Think lymphatic support, hydration, and sun protection.
